1985 Lancia Delta vs. 2011 Audi A5
To start off, 2011 Audi A5 is newer by 26 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Lancia Delta.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Lancia Delta would be higher. At 1,968 cc (4 cylinders), 2011 Audi A5 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2011 Audi A5 (141 HP @ 4200 RPM) has 1 more horse power than 1985 Lancia Delta. (140 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2011 Audi A5 should accelerate faster than 1985 Lancia Delta.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2011 Audi A5 (320 Nm @ 1750 RPM) has 129 more torque (in Nm) than 1985 Lancia Delta. (191 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 2011 Audi A5 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1985 Lancia Delta.
